Cloud Render Pipeline Details

Each export job queues on a cloud GPU node that composites video layers, applies platform-spec compression (H.264, up to 1080x1920), and returns a download URL within 30-90 seconds. The session token carries render job IDs, so closing the tab before completion orphans the job.

Include Authorization: Bearer \x3CNEMO_TOKEN> and all attribution headers on every request — omitting them triggers a 402 on export.

Three attribution headers are required on every request and must match this file's frontmatter:

Header Value
X-Skill-Source free-image-to-video-generator-ai
X-Skill-Version frontmatter version
X-Skill-Platform auto-detect: clawhub / cursor / unknown from install path

API base: https://mega-api-prod.nemovideo.ai

Create session: POST /api/tasks/me/with-session/nemo_agent — body {"task_name":"project","language":"\x3Clang>"} — returns task_id, session_id.

Send message (SSE): POST /run_sse — body {"app_name":"nemo_agent","user_id":"me","session_id":"\x3Csid>","new_message":{"parts":[{"text":"\x3Cmsg>"}]}} with Accept: text/event-stream. Max timeout: 15 minutes.

Upload: POST /api/upload-video/nemo_agent/me/\x3Csid> — file: multipart -F "files=@/path", or URL: {"urls":["\x3Curl>"],"source_type":"url"}

Credits: GET /api/credits/balance/simple — returns available, frozen, total

Session state: GET /api/state/nemo_agent/me/\x3Csid>/latest — key fields: data.state.draft, data.state.video_infos, data.state.generated_media

Export (free, no credits): POST /api/render/proxy/lambda — body {"id":"render_\x3Cts>","sessionId":"\x3Csid>","draft":\x3Cjson>,"output":{"format":"mp4","quality":"high"}}. Poll GET /api/render/proxy/lambda/\x3Cid> every 30s until status = completed. Download URL at output.url.

Supported formats: mp4, mov, avi, webm, mkv, jpg, png, gif, webp, mp3, wav, m4a, aac.

Error Handling

Code Meaning Action
0 Success Continue
1001 Bad/expired token Re-auth via anonymous-token (tokens expire after 7 days)
1002 Session not found New session §3.0
2001 No credits Anonymous: show registration URL with ?bind=\x3Cid> (get \x3Cid> from create-session or state response when needed). Registered: "Top up credits in your account"
4001 Unsupported file Show supported formats
4002 File too large Suggest compress/trim
400 Missing X-Client-Id Generate Client-Id and retry (see §1)
402 Free plan export blocked Subscription tier issue, NOT credits. "Register or upgrade your plan to unlock export."
429 Rate limit (1 token/client/7 days) Retry in 30s once

Reading the SSE Stream

Text events go straight to the user (after GUI translation). Tool calls stay internal. Heartbeats and empty data: lines mean the backend is still working — show "⏳ Still working..." every 2 minutes.

About 30% of edit operations close the stream without any text. When that happens, poll /api/state to confirm the timeline changed, then tell the user what was updated.

Draft JSON uses short keys: t for tracks, tt for track type (0=video, 1=audio, 7=text), sg for segments, d for duration in ms, m for metadata.

Example timeline summary:

Timeline (3 tracks): 1. Video: city timelapse (0-10s) 2. BGM: Lo-fi (0-10s, 35%) 3. Title: "Urban Dreams" (0-3s)

Capability Assessment
Purpose & Capability
The name/description (convert images to video) aligns with the API endpoints and actions described in SKILL.md (upload, render, export). Requesting a NEMO_TOKEN as the primary credential is consistent with a cloud rendering service. However, registry metadata says no config paths while the skill frontmatter includes a configPaths entry (~/.config/nemovideo/), which is an inconsistency the publisher should clarify.
Instruction Scope
The SKILL.md instructs the agent to obtain or use NEMO_TOKEN, create sessions, upload user files, start SSE streams, and poll render endpoints — all expected for a cloud renderer. Concerns: (1) the doc asks the agent to 'auto-detect' platform from an install path (this may require reading agent install/config paths), and (2) it tells the agent how to generate an anonymous token if NEMO_TOKEN is absent despite NEMO_TOKEN being declared required in registry metadata. The instructions also require adding custom attribution headers; constructing them may require reading frontmatter values or the environment. These gaps create ambiguity about what filesystem/env access the agent will perform.
Install Mechanism
Instruction-only skill (no install spec, no code files). This is low-risk from an install perspective because nothing is downloaded or written by a package installer.
Credentials
Only NEMO_TOKEN is declared as required, which is proportional for a cloud API. However the runtime doc supports acquiring an anonymous token itself if NEMO_TOKEN is absent, meaning the declared 'required env var' is optional in practice — this mismatch should be clarified. The skill does not request unrelated credentials.
Persistence & Privilege
always is false and autonomous invocation is allowed (platform default). The skill instructs the agent to 'keep the returned session_id' but does not specify persistent storage location; that could be ephemeral memory or agent-managed storage. There's no explicit request to modify system-wide settings or other skills.
